The course aims to provide dentists with the opportunity to analyse the need for the management of pain and anxiety in dentistry. Students will develop critical knowledge and advanced understanding of the development of the theories and concepts that underpin the field of conscious sedation. The course has been designed to fulfil contemporary guidelines in conscious sedation, providing future proficient practitioners for the NHS and teachers for educational environments in management of pain and anxiety.

Requirements

Suitable for postgraduate dental students with a minimum 2:2 Bachelor of Dental Surgery or equivalent and a registerable dental qualification and with an interest in pain and anxiety management in dentistry.

Applicants whose first language is not English will be required to pass either IELTS/TEOFL exams. Minimum requirements are normally IELTS band 7.0 or TOEFL 600 (250 for computer-based test).
